Output 153dc572760420968df36b55a067bf59565d7dbd2ae7da74a92fb7fde0173325:0

value
104228288
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 39902a5f8b1b50ec6a59135a29a07c7d3a90cf00 OP_EQUALVERIFY OP_CHECKSIG
address
16FNDjMiVcetNEJ8a1MUXBiqeU8MGHQSd2
transaction
153dc572760420968df36b55a067bf59565d7dbd2ae7da74a92fb7fde0173325
spent
true